No its not lapis, Ill get a couple of in focus photos and put them up didnt realise it focused on the background last night
 
Interesting. Apparently afghanite is a cancrinite-group felspathoid unlike lazulite (which is a sodalite group felspathoid). Apparently the two minerals (lazulite and afghanite) occur together in Afghanistan. So it is an actual mineral name not a gem name (had never heard of it).
 
Theres slight differences between them both that distinguishes them apart

Its 5.5 to 6 on the mohs scale and nice to carve so maybe pendant or just keep it in a collection
 
Its 22.2mm long and 13.2mm x 11.0mm x11.9mm along the widest sections of the 3 flattest sides. Heres another piece I rough shaped with my dremel. I have a fair bit of it around the 20ct size
